EXAMPLE



The most valuable gift you can give another is a good example.

"For I have given you an example, that you should do as I have done to you."

(John: 13:15)

In his autobiography, Armand Hammer known as much for his humanitarian efforts as for being chairman and CEO of Occidental Petroleum, an advisor to presidents from Roosevelt to Reagan, and an industrialist reveals the roots of his giving spirit:

"My father had become a prominent and greatly love figure in the area. . .It was an almost ecstatic experience for me to ride with him when he was on his doctor's rounds. . .Patients at their doors greeted him with such a warmth that waves of pride and honor would surge in me to find myself the son of such a father, a man so obviously good, so obviously deserving of the affection he received. He could have, however, made himself many times richer if he had insisted on collecting all of his bills; or if he could have restrained himself from giving money away; but then he would not have been the man he was. . .I have seen, in his office, drawers full of unpaid bills for which he refused to demand payment because he knew the difficult circumstances of the patients. And I heard innumerable stories from patients about leaving money behind to pay for the prescriptions he had written when he visited people who were too poor to eat, let alone pay the doctor."

What a wonderful legacy to leave your child the "business" of loving and giving to others.
